2. Scenic Neighborhoods and Coastal Communities
Some of the most sought-after areas include:
Calypso Bay Apartments: Modern apartments with ocean views, ideal for professionals, retirees, and vacationers.
Frigate Bay: Popular for its beaches, restaurants, and vibrant nightlife.
Bird Rock & Conaree: Affordable yet accessible residential areas for families.

What to Consider When Renting a House in St. Kitts
Before renting a property, there are key factors to keep in mind:
1. Location
Proximity to beaches, schools, markets, and healthcare can significantly impact your experience. Areas like Calypso Bay apartments provide easy access to local amenities while maintaining a peaceful residential atmosphere.
2. Budget
St. Kitts houses for rent vary widely in price. Luxury villas or beachfront properties will cost more than inland homes. Set a budget that includes rent, utilities, and maintenance.
3. Amenities
Consider amenities such as:
Swimming pool access
Gated security
Modern kitchens and appliances
Parking spaces
Many apartments and houses in communities like Calypso Bay include these features, enhancing comfort and convenience.
4. Lease Terms
Ensure clarity about:
Lease duration
Deposit requirements
Pet policies
Maintenance responsibilities
Reading the lease carefully prevents future disputes.

2. Research Neighborhoods
Check the safety, accessibility, and local amenities of the area before signing a lease. Visiting in person or consulting local experts can prevent future inconveniences.
3. Understand the Rental Process
Application requirements (ID, references, proof of income)
Security deposits (usually one month’s rent)
Utility setup responsibilities
Knowing the process ahead of time ensures a smooth move-in experience.
